  • 摘要:To examine the effect of consuming polyphenol-rich Oriental plum (Prunus salicina Lindl) on the cognitive performance and the expressions of cerebral neurodegeneration-related proteins in diabetic rats, Wistar rats were assigned into 4 groups: control (C, n = 14), nicotinamide/streptozotocin-induced DM rats (DM, n = 13), DM rats fed metformin (0.05% w/w in the diet, MT, n = 18), and DM rats fed freeze-dried oriental plum powder (2% w/w in the diet, OP, n = 16) for 2 months. The cognitive performance was evaluated by testing in a Morris water maze. The insulin resistance, serum lipid peroxidation, expressions of pathological proteins of AD, beta-amyloid (Aβ) and phosphorylated tau protein were also measured. Consumption of plums significantly improved the spatial learning ability, reduced the insulin resistance, lipid peroxidation, Aβ and phosphorylated tau protein expressions in the cerebral cortex (all P β deposition in the hippocampus of diabetic rats. In conclusion, polyphenol-rich Oriental plums ameliorated the cognitive decline and reduced the expressions of pathological proteins of AD by possibly reducing hyperglycemia, insulin resistance, and oxidative stress in diabetic rats.
